Greek2212

ζητέω

zēteō

Basic Gloss

zēteō is a Greek word meaning "to seek (literally or figuratively)", encompassing ideas like be about, desire, endeavour, enquire.

to seek (literally or figuratively); specially, (by Hebraism) to worship (God), or (in a bad sense) to plot (against life)

The Greek word zēteō means "to seek (literally or figuratively); specially, (by Hebraism) to worship (God), or (in a bad sense) to plot (against life)," encompassing related ideas including be about, desire, endeavour, enquire.
